    <description>The High Court upheld the Tribunal&#039;s decision to set aside penalty orders in two appeals related to Section 271(1)(c) of the Income Tax Act, 1961. The Court emphasized the requirement of a specific direction for penalty initiation in the assessment order for the deeming provision of the Finance Act, 2008 to apply. Since such direction was absent in the assessment orders, the deeming provision did not come into effect, rendering the penalty orders invalid due to the lack of the Assessing Officer&#039;s satisfaction. The appeals were dismissed, highlighting the importance of satisfying procedural requirements for penalty proceedings.</description>
